What Are the Different Styles of Sofa Beds Available?
There are several popular styles of sofa beds available, each catering to different preferences and needs.
- Traditional Sofa Bed: This style features a fold-out mattress hidden within the sofa, providing a classic look while offering a comfortable sleeping space.
- Futons: Futons are versatile and often have a minimalist design that allows them to convert easily from a sofa to a bed by folding down the backrest.
- Sectional Sofa Beds: Sectionals with a sleeper option combine multiple seating arrangements with the functionality of a bed, making them ideal for larger spaces.
- Click-Clack Sofa Beds: These sofa beds can be transformed into a sleeping surface by simply clicking the backrest down, offering a modern and straightforward mechanism.
- Convertible Sofa Beds: This style allows for various configurations and can include features like adjustable backs, making them suitable for both lounging and sleeping comfortably.
- Daybeds: Daybeds function as both a sofa and a bed, often styled with decorative elements and can be used for lounging during the day and sleeping at night.
The traditional sofa bed typically has a metal frame and a mattress that pulls out from underneath the seating cushions, providing a reliable sleeping solution while maintaining a classic aesthetic.
Futons are made with a mattress that folds, and their simple design makes them ideal for small spaces, as they can easily transition from a couch to a bed, making them perfect for guest rooms or studios.
Sectional sofa beds are advantageous for larger living spaces, allowing for flexible seating arrangements while also providing ample sleeping space for guests without compromising style.
Click-clack sofa beds are known for their ease of use; with a simple mechanism, the backrest folds down flat, creating a sleeping area quickly, making them a practical choice for those who frequently host visitors.
Convertible sofa beds offer multiple ways to configure the sofa, often including features that allow users to adjust the backrest or armrests, making them versatile and comfortable for various activities.
Daybeds serve a dual purpose, acting as both a bed and a seating area, and are often designed with decorative headboards and side panels that enhance their aesthetic appeal while providing functionality.

What Factors Should You Consider When Selecting a Sofa Bed Style?
Comfort level is vital since a sofa bed is used for both sitting and sleeping. Test the sofa bed in-store if possible, focusing on the firmness of the mattress and the seating comfort to ensure it meets your expectations.
Functionality includes understanding how often the sofa bed will be used and for what purpose. If it will serve as a primary sleeping option for guests, you may want a more robust model that is easy to convert, while occasional use may allow for more flexibility in style.
Fabric and durability are significant considerations, especially for families or homes with pets. Look for materials that can withstand wear and tear, and consider options that are stain-resistant or easy to clean to maintain the sofa bed’s appearance over time.
Finally, establish a price range that reflects the balance between quality and your budget. It’s important to remember that investing in a higher-quality sofa bed can lead to better durability and comfort, which may save money in the long run by reducing the need for replacements.

What Are the Advantages and Disadvantages of Each Sofa Bed Style?
| Style | Advantages | Disadvantages |
|---|---|---|
| Futon | Space-saving, versatile for sleeping and lounging, lightweight, easy to clean. | Less cushioning, may not be as comfortable for long-term use, can be less supportive. |
| Pull-out Sofa Bed | Easy to convert, provides a full bed experience, often includes a comfortable mattress. | Takes more space when pulled out, can be heavy to operate, requires more effort to set up. |
| Convertible Sofa | Stylish, often comes with additional storage options, adaptable to different spaces. | May be pricier, complex mechanisms can wear out, can be less comfortable as a sofa. |
| Daybed | Can be used as a sofa, offers a distinctive look, can fit into various decor styles. | Limited sleeping space, not ideal for multiple users, potentially limited mattress options. |
